ZIP 54113 Foreclosure, Tax-Lien & Distress Report

Outagamie County, Wisconsin · Distress market

Scored purely from public records, 54113 (Outagamie County, Wisconsin) returns a low composite of 23/100. Structural risk reads 51/100 against active distress of 2/100. Environmental exposure also runs high (climate & FEMA risk (83/100), flood (NFIP) exposure (76/100)). Leading the profile are structural risk (51/100), institutional ownership (45/100), mortgage stress (7/100). On the quiet end sit mortgage stress (7/100).

The market reads peak — home values rose 4.8% year on year, and 15% higher over three years, at 30/100 phase confidence. Topping markets hide individual distress behind strong averages.

The tenure split is 87% owner-occupied to 13% rented. Around 31%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. Home values center near $246,000, an affordability ratio of 2.6× — accessible. At $89,310, median income runs above typical U.S. levels. Population is roughly 3,633 with a median age of 45. There are about 1,375 housing units across 54113. The demographic-stress sub-score lands at 19/100. Rent burden reaches 13% of tenant households. Vacancy runs 1.2%. Roughly 1.7% live below the poverty line, a low share typical of higher-equity areas.
